russia attacks Danube ports of Ukraine with kamikaze drones

On the night of August 16, the russian army attacked Odesa region twice with kamikaze drones, the head of the Odesa Region Military Administration Oleg Kiper reported in Telegram.

"The port and grain infrastructure in the south of the region is the principal target. One of the Danube ports was hit by the enemy. Warehouses and grain storage facilities were severely damaged. The fires were quickly extinguished by the State Emergency Service," the message reads.

No casualties have been reported.

The Air Defence Forces downed 11 kamikaze drones of the 13 launched.
